Congress Protests Alleged Remarks on Ambedkar by Home Minister

“Jai Bapu Jai Bhim Jai Samvidhan” Events Held Nationwide

Key Points:

  • Congress organizes district-level programs against alleged remarks on Ambedkar.
  • Protest held at Tilak Library in Bistupur, led by district president.
  • Party accuses central government of misleading the public.

JAMSHEDPUR – The Congress party launched a series of protests titled “Jai Bapu Jai Bhim Jai Samvidhan” across district headquarters in response to alleged remarks by Home Minister Amit Shah about Dr. B.R. Ambedkar. A significant program was held at Tilak Library in Bistupur on Wednesday, with party leaders criticizing the central government’s policies.

District-Level Protest in Jamshedpur

The event at Tilak Library was led by the district Congress president and attended by senior party members and supporters. Party leaders expressed strong disapproval of the alleged statements and accused the central government of undermining the legacy of Dr. Ambedkar.

The district Congress president stated, “This program aims to expose the central government’s misleading policies and false promises. The administration is using divisive tactics instead of addressing real issues.”

Criticism of Central Government Policies

The working president of the Congress party accused the government of adopting double standards. “The central government is only trying to mislead the public with its deceptive strategies. Today, we stand united against these unfair policies,” he remarked during the event.

The protest highlighted the Congress party’s call for justice and reaffirmed its commitment to safeguarding the Constitution and Dr. Ambedkar’s vision.
